John G. Burger, 60, of Jasper, passed away at 8:30 p.m. CDT, on Tuesday, June 12, 2018 at Select Specialty Hospital in Evansville.

John was born in Jasper on September 14, 1957, to Virgil and Anna Mae (Schnaus) Burger.  He married Cathrine Titzer on November 13, 1993, in St. Joseph Catholic Church in Jasper.

John was a fifth generation independent turkey farmer.

He was active in local politics, serving the public for 18 years, first as a County Councilman and later as a County Commissioner.

He was a member of Precious Blood Catholic Church in Jasper, where he had served on the school board.

He enjoyed gardening, coaching and watching his children play sports, and was an avid Purdue sports and University of Evansville basketball fan.

Surviving are his wife, Cathrine Burger of Jasper; three daughters, Jordan Burger, Indianapolis, Olivia Burger, Jasper, and Emily Burger, Jasper; one son Caleb Burger, Jasper; his mother, Anna Mae Burger, Jasper; two sisters, Kathy Hopf (Gary), Jasper, and Lisa Melloh (Nick), Indianapolis; and two brothers, Mike Burger (Shannon), Chesterfield, Missouri, and Jim Burger (Beth), Evansville.

Preceding him in death was his father, Virgil Burger.
